Dr. Paul Fernyhough is a Professor in the Department of Pharmacology and Therapeutics at the University of Manitoba's Max Rady College of Medicine and directs the Division of Neurodegenerative and Neurodevelopmental Disorders at St. Boniface Hospital Albrechtsen Research Centre. His research focuses on mechanisms of nerve damage in diabetes and Alzheimer's disease, with emphasis on cholinergic signaling, GPCR pathways, and drug design. He co-founded WinSanTor Inc., a biotech firm advancing clinical trials for peripheral neuropathy.
Education: BSc (Biology, University of Essex, 1981) and PhD (Biochemistry, University of Sheffield, 1984). Postdoctoral training included Colorado State University, King’s College London, and a Wellcome Trust Fellowship at St. Bartholomew’s Medical College. Previously held a tenured position at the University of Manchester before moving to Canada in 1998.
Research affiliations include Diabetes Action Canada, Manitoba Neuroscience Network, and leadership roles in the Cell Biology of Neurodegeneration Lab. His work investigates axonal degeneration, mitochondrial function, and antimuscarinic drug therapies, aiming to address unmet needs in neurodegenerative diseases.
